

When using certain filaments such as filaments with particles or fibres, as well as when changing from one material to another with different printing temperatures, it is highly recommended to use cleaning material to free the inside of the hotend and the nozzle from material residues and thus avoid blockages in the 3D printer.

With the combination of cleaning material pellets and a good filament extruder such as Filastruder, it is possible to obtain 3D printing filament with qualities similar to those of a commercial cleaning filament. The use of this filament extends the life of the nozzles.
When using cleaning material pellets to make filament with a filament extruder such as Filastruder or using a pellet extruder for direct 3D printing, it should be noted that the extrusion temperature must be regulated in relation to the extrusion speed used. Once the cleaning filament has been manufactured, it is very easy to use. You only have to take into account the extrusion temperature. Simply heat the extruder 10ºC higher than the temperature of the last material that was printed and extrude a certain amount of filament (>1 metre).
Once the specified amount of cleaning filament has been extruded, the new filament must be removed and loaded.
